Thoracic cage anatomy

this image shows the bones that form the thoracic cage from anterior view (the vertebrae , the ribs and the sternum)

showing:
1. thoracic vertebrae
2. manubrium of the sternum
3. body of the sternum
4. xiphoid process of the sternum
5. ribs
6. costal cartilages
7. true ribs (1--7)
8. false ribs (8--12)
9. vertebrocondral ribs (8--10) "the ribs reaches the cartilages"
10. floating ribs (11-12) "they don't have cartilages"
